Skip to main content

Taranis AI Models

Project description

Taranis AI Pydantic Models

This folder provides pydantic models for validation of data sent between Taranis AI services and offered to third party clients.

Installation

It's recommended to use a uv to set up a virtual environment.

curl -LsSf https://astral.sh/uv/install.sh | sh
uv sync

If updating something and wanting to test it in frontend or core you can use install_and_run_dev.sh or something similar to the commands below:

uv sync --all-extras --frozen --python 3.13
uv pip install -e ../models

export UV_NO_SYNC=true
uv run pytest tests

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

taranis_models-1.2.5.dev11.tar.gz (26.5 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

taranis_models-1.2.5.dev11-py3-none-any.whl (14.9 kB view details)

Uploaded Python 3

File details

Details for the file taranis_models-1.2.5.dev11.tar.gz.

File metadata

File hashes

Hashes for taranis_models-1.2.5.dev11.tar.gz
Algorithm Hash digest
SHA256 a7c93636d81a6ad9a65770ec79c6e620e45325e41fe35b94773851e484c06a1a
MD5 f6bbcd4fba7357fc41ddaca67397f1ed
BLAKE2b-256 f7e57c51adb7c1315cfbc94f35367c24a74d58126ff20693b04de00ae925f4da

See more details on using hashes here.

File details

Details for the file taranis_models-1.2.5.dev11-py3-none-any.whl.

File metadata

File hashes

Hashes for taranis_models-1.2.5.dev11-py3-none-any.whl
Algorithm Hash digest
SHA256 b2814772590e82b4f44eab3899d43d929161ed80cb91c9fd7996752696ef2268
MD5 5f3800a79fb7518952307ec004560192
BLAKE2b-256 c7f46512251e98b961b0dc2510bcee0bf7d1ac0769fd0d4bd002785f94abf651

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page